Transaction 037d62ce9348f15500afccdafbcdfeb7964281f9d67c1fca56ef3598913210bf

1 Input
2 Outputs
  • 037d62ce9348f15500afccdafbcdfeb7964281f9d67c1fca56ef3598913210bf:0
  • value  6848028020
    address  2NA5b4aXtfdbHF1HWEjMJRmbPy63uiEJskc
  • 037d62ce9348f15500afccdafbcdfeb7964281f9d67c1fca56ef3598913210bf:1
  • value  3389875
    address  2N2K3YoHGmMS84vBNCmHWuRdxdVkZ93RQWB